There are concerns as well as support for the announcement that health staff in England will be have to be vaccinated by April
NHS staff in England will be have to be vaccinated against Covid by April in order to keep their jobs, the health secretary has announced.
While 90% of NHS staff are fully vaccinated, there remain 103,000 workers who have not had a single dose, Sajid Javid said. Staff will be offered one-to-one meetings with clinicians if they want to discuss their concerns.
